Its all over...Marcus Ferbrache
The crew enjoyed the final party in the Pan American Club in Liverpool's Albert Dock on Saturday evening, with many of the past leggers there to join in with the round the worlders and leg 7 crew.  There, and in Jersey the week before, it has been really great to catch up with the team members who were on board for the early parts of the race and have already had a good few months back in "civilian" life!
 
Jersey Clipper left the Albert Dock mid afternoon on Monday bound for Jersey for a final weekend visit.  Most of the Jersey Clipper crew have dispersed back to their homes around the UK to start their return to normality but a number of keen crewmembers deciding to stay aboard for one more week to complete this "lap of honour". They spent Wednesday evening in Dartmouth and arrived in St. Helier on Thursday evening.
 
A steady stream of members of the public visited the boat on Saturday including a few people who are interested in taking part in the next Clipper Round The World Race which begins in September 2007.  Any potential crew members should take a look at the Clipper Ventures web site for more details.
 
Jersey Clipper slips her lines at 1400 today for the short hop to her home port of Gosport in Hampshire where she will be refitted in preparation for the next race.
